(often stylized as Pınar Can ) is a Turkish folk and regional music artist known for her performances in the Barak and Kilis musical traditions. One of her notable pieces is " Gülemedim Yanbağlama " (sometimes performed as a medley or potpourri), which showcases the high-energy, percussive style typical of weddings and regional celebrations in southeastern Turkey.
